Christell Ervin 74,  went to be with her Lord and Savior Monday, September 23, 2019 at FirstHealth Moore Regional Hospital, Pinehurst, NC, surrounded by her family.

Funeral Service will be 3:00 PM, Friday, September 27, 2019 at The Methodist Church of Spies, 3119 Spies Road, Robbins, NC, with the Reverend Gary Melchin and Reverend Allen Hale officiating. Burial will follow in Browns Chapel Christian Church Cemetery.    The family will receive friends prior to the service beginning at 2:00 PM and following the Committal at The Methodist Church of Spies Fellowship Hall. 

Christell was born in Dillon SC on December 10, 1944 to the late Chapman and Mary McDougal Jacobs. She worked with her family on the farm growing up.  She enjoyed cooking, making crafts, and traveling to new places. Christell was a loving daughter, sister, and aunt. She enjoyed family gatherings and time spent with friends. As a resident at Pinelake, she enjoyed playing bingo with her friends there. Christell was preceded in death by niece: Esther Collins.

Christell is survived by sister: Wanda Hale and husband Allen, of Randleman; brothers: Daniel Jacobs and wife Mary, of Robbins, Lonnie Jacobs and wife Linda, of Robbins; 2 nieces,  1 nephew, 2 great nieces, 2 great great nieces, 1 great great nephew and many friends.
